Suzuki Daisetsu uncovered the Bodhidharma Anthology (in a collection [housed in Beijing] from the Dunhuang Caves) but overlooked the significance of what Broughton calls âRecords: One, Two and Threeâ. . In the early part of this century, the discovery of a walled-up cave in northwest China led to the retrieval of a lost early Ch'an (Zen) literature of the T'ang dynasty (618-907).
